Court Appointed Special Advocates (CASA) are community volunteers, just like you, who stand up and speak out to help children who have been abused and neglected.

The Tennessee CASA program currently serves 5,230 children in 56 counties.

As a CASA Volunteer, you will help an abused or neglected child in our county navigate through the court system working with DCS and the Child/Family team to make sure all the child’s needs are being met and reporting to the court the progress made so that the child can thrive in a safe, loving and permanent home.
